Hello plugin authors,

Next Thursday, Corbexa will run a disaster-recovery drill for the RestockRoute vending-machine restock planner. During the failover window, plugin callbacks will be replayed against the standby scheduler, so please ensure your handlers are idempotent and tolerate duplicate route assignments. No customer restock data will be altered. To re-register your plugin against the standby environment during the drill, authenticate with the recovery passphrase provided below.

vault phrase of hahip-tajeg = quenax-briath-briax

Minutes — management meeting, Halloway Instruments, prepared for the incoming director. Attendees reviewed the launch plan for the Meridia sensor range. Agreed: soft launch in the Casterbrook region first, full rollout eight weeks later. Marketing budget approved as submitted; packaging revisions due by month end. Elin Szabo to own the distributor briefings. The strategic reasoning behind the staggered timeline is set out below.

board note of kagep-yahig: Only 9 of the 120 pilot accounts renewed Quenix, so a churn review is set for April 1.

Handover: Stormline Fan-out (from Dela to incoming owner)

Plugin authors hit the dispatch layer via the relay hooks only — don't let them touch the queue directly. Known quirks: county-level alerts fan out twice if severity is upgraded mid-broadcast (dedupe handles it), and the Kestrel region shard is slower than the rest. Rate limits are enforced per plugin, not per endpoint. Docs for the hook API live in the repo wiki. The current production configuration is listed below.

config for kagup-hahig:
druwyn:
  pin: 2801
  metrics_host: metrics.druwyn.zemvarlabs.internal
  tenant: sorius
  seal: seal_798a43d7

Subject: Turnstile upgrade next week — heads up!

Hi all, quick note from the front desk at Pellow Point: the old turnstiles in the main lobby are being swapped out Monday to Wednesday. Expect queues and a few grumbles. The side gate by the plant wall will be the main way in, and it runs on a keypad rather than badge taps. When letting staff or visitors through, enter the gate code below.

staff pass of haweg-bafop = bdg-G-69